1,1,3,3,5,5,7,7,9,9,11,11,13,13-Tetradecamethylheptasiloxane

≥95%

  • Product Code: 88062
  CAS:    19095-23-9
Molecular Weight: 505.1 g./mol Molecular Formula: C₁₄H₄₄O₆Si₇
EC Number: MDL Number:
Melting Point: Boiling Point: 128°C/2mmHg(lit.)
Density: Storage Condition: room temperature
Product Description: This chemical is primarily used as a silicone fluid in various industrial and commercial applications due to its excellent thermal stability, low surface tension, and hydrophobic properties. It is commonly employed as a lubricant in high-temperature environments, where it reduces friction and wear in mechanical systems. Additionally, it serves as a key ingredient in the formulation of personal care products, such as hair conditioners and skin creams, where it provides a smooth, non-greasy feel and enhances moisture retention. In the electronics industry, it is utilized as a dielectric fluid and in the production of silicone-based coatings to protect components from moisture and corrosion. Its inert nature also makes it suitable for use in medical devices and as a release agent in manufacturing processes.
